 "I am so sorry that I am a part of this society and culture. I am so sorry that I am a man. I promise I will fight with your voice," said superstar Shah Rukh Khan as he joined other Bollywood personalities to mourn the death of 23-year-old gangrape victim today.

The victim was taken to Mount Elizabeth Hospital in Singapore for further treatment after her condition deteriorated. She was being treated at Delhi's Safdarjang Hospital after being brutally assaulted on the night of 16 December in South Delhi.

"We couldn't save u but wot a big voice u have, u brave little girl. That voice is telling us that rape is not an aberration, not a mistake. Rape embodies sexuality as our culture & society has defined it.

Reuters

"I am so sorry that I am a part of this society and culture. I am so sorry that I am a man. I promise I will fight with ur voice. I will respect women, so that I gain my daughter's respect (sic)," said SRK, 47, who is father of son Aryan and 12-year-old daughter Suhana.

The heinous incident has triggered nationwide outrage with people taking to streets to demand death penalty for the criminals and better safety laws for women.

Shah Rukh Khan apparently wants to let bygones be bygones and usher 2013 on a new footing
It appears that Shah Rukh Khan is keen to rebuild Brand SRK in the New Year. The turn of the year seems to be heralding a spanking new image for King Khan. The star apparently wants to let bygones be bygones and usher 2013 on a new footing. There were indications that the scenario was changing for quite a while. And now the picture is getting clearer.

For starters, SRK has acquired a new publicist who has been filling our in-boxes with updates about the star from his trip to the Marrakech film festival to his reaping accolades at a recent film awards show. There are snapshots along with a brief of what he has been up to. This definitely came as a surprise but it looks like there is a need to streamline and provide information about him.

B-Town has this penchant to work in camps. But SRK broke the rules when he agreed to work with Katrina Kaif, the ex-girlfriend of his nemesis Salman Khan. His decision to act in director Rohit Shetty's film- a name synonymous with Ajay Devgn- another bete noire of SRK, too proves that professionally his brand wants to work with the big names in the industry.

Karan Johar, of late, has been bonding with the other Khan big time. With whispers about SRK and his best buddy KJo's bonding not exactly being the way it was, King Khan seems to be forging new bonds.

The year that was 2012 began on a sticky situation when he had an alleged altercation with director Shirish Kunder at Sanjay Dutt's bash for Agneepath in January-end. In May came his infamous squabble with the security officials at the Wankhede Stadium. Then there were also reports about his extra close bonding with Priyanka Chopra.

Actor and filmmaker Sohail Khan, who is part ofCelebrity Cricket League (CCL), seems to be very professional and says it would be great if superstar Shah Rukh Khan ever decides to join it.

The CCL has eight teams and Sohail plays for the Mumbai Heroes.

"He's (SRK) a part of the industry and he is a very big star. He has his own IPL (Indian Premier League) team and if he would like to come and support CCL or any of the teams, there's going to be games in Kolkata, Pune," said the 42-year-old whose brother Salman and SRK are at loggerheads.

"We all are part of one industry, I still call him Shah Rukh Bhai, things don't change. We all are a part of the industry and we all are friends, he is most welcome. We'll be glad if he supports us," he added.

Meanwhile, actor Riteish Deshmukh, who has started his own CCL team named Veer Marathi, says he will strive to beat his earlier team Mumbai Heroes.

"When we play a cricket match, we will try our best to beat the opposite team and after winning we will give them a nice hug," Riteish said in Mumbai.

Bollywood's most phenomenal star, Shahrukh Khan, is set to perform his "Temptation ReloadedConcert in Indonesia on Saturday, 8th December  2012 to be held  at the Sentul International Convention Center, in Bogor, just at the outskirt of Jakarta

For his long-awaited performance this time, the Bollywood mega star will be accompanied by some of the most popular Indian actresses including Rani MukherjeePreity Zinta, and Bipasha Basu.

Ten years ago, the Bollywood superstar successfully mesmerized thousands of his fans at Hall C Jakarta International Expo with the Bollywood Extarvaganza show. This time, Shahrukh Khan plans to throw an even a bigger bang with a special and grand scale stage that can accommodate up to 20 to 30 dancers. According to the promoter, the lighting system will be exceptional and brought directly from Singapore. For this performance, Shahrukh Khan is reportedly supported by a team of 115 people.

Organized in Jakarta by MD Entertainment in collaboration with promoter Java Musikindo, Shah Rukh Khan, Rani Muherjee, Preity Zinta, Bipasha Basu, and tens of dancers will indulge the Jakarta audience with distinct Indian songs and captivating dance choreography for over 2 hours. 7,500 tickets have been prepared for the show by the promoters, ranging from IDR500,000 to IDR3,500,000.  Tickets are reported to be picked up very fast. 

Shahrukh Khan, who is also referred to as SRK, was born on 2nd November 1965. To date, he has acted in 77 films, almost all of which have been successful in India. Moreover, many of his films have crossed international borders and are widely viewed in various countries with large followers , not the least in Indonesia. Films such as Kuch Kuch Hota Hai, Kabhi Khushi Kabhie Gham, Mohabbatein, Om Shanti Om, Asoka and Don were among the most successful and phenomenal films in the history of Bollywood. 

Another spectacular success was My Name is Khan, based on the aftermath of the 9/11 WTC attack. The film, which details the life of a Muslim living in New York after the tragedy, grabbed international attention and acclaim. Aside from acting, he has been blessed with the ability to wow audiences through his quick wit and humor, as well as his famed song and dance moves.
